    • He didn’t get any attention in Spring Training because Albert Suarez was the noteworthy out-of-nowhere old MiL contract, but keep an eye on Luis Gonzalez. He’s a soft-tossing lefty RP, but he has an elite top 1-5% spin fastball - around 2450 RPMs. The fastball is only 91-92 MPH, but that spin rate caught my eye in Spring Training as is clearly why he was brought in as a 32 year old who hasn’t pitched in the minor leagues since 2021. He unfortunately doesn’t have the same ability for spin on the breaking balls, but that’s still a lot to work with. Now, in 16.2 IP he’s got 25/3 K/BB and only 1 HR, good for a 3.78 ERA, 2.32 FIP, 3.38 xFIP. Very high fly ball % as you might expect for a fastball with that spin, so he might be the type that can get a lot of soft fly balls and run a better FIP than xFIP. For what it’s worth, Steamer already projects him for 3.93 ERA / 4.19 FIP at the MLB level, and that will quickly adjust if his sample size of performance at this level in AAA increases. Vespi is still on the 40-man and has an option, but he’s been struggling with walks in AAA and his FIP/xFIP are pretty awful despite the nice ERA. I wouldn’t be surprised to see Gonzalez leapfrog him if the need for a lefty RP arises, although the option and already being on the 40-man definitely work in Vespi’s favor if it’s a short-term thing.
